Transaction 966826f49a38a4a03ee51a252f57eef9b55dd38e415d39620c067b291cd0330a
1 Input
1 Output
-
966826f49a38a4a03ee51a252f57eef9b55dd38e415d39620c067b291cd0330a:0
- value
- 2182235
- script pubkey
- OP_0 OP_PUSHBYTES_20 b0bfcf9af51417f2862cd7620c1c5bf154bb318d
- address
- bc1qkzlulxh4zstl9p3v6a3qc8zm792tkvvdmhwu05